Clippers vs. Nuggets| Game 1 Recap

Clippers and Nuggets logo with their star players. Kawhi Leonard, James Harden, Nikola Jokic, Russell Westbrook

The Nuggets look to keep this from being a lost season.

Result: Nuggets (112) – Clippers (110)

The Clippers and Nuggets are two teams with an abundance of postseason experience, both rosters are stacked with talent and both teams came to fight in Game 1. It was James Harden that led the way for the the Clippers, scoring 32 points to go along with 11 assists and 6 rebounds.

Jokic finished with 29 points, 9 rebounds and 12 assists in their overtime win, playing 46 of the potential 53 minutes of Game 1. The Nuggets had 3 players score 20 or more and 5 players reach double digits. On the other side, it was Ivica Zubac and Kawhi Leonard helping to lighten the scoring load, each adding 21 and 22 points, respectively.

Nuggets interim Head Coach decided to close the game with Russ over Michael Porter Jr., a move that ended up proving key with Russ scoring 9 of his 15 points in the 4th quarter.

Instant Classic

The two teams exchanged blows throughout the game, 11 lead changes, 7 ties and the Nuggets biggest lead of the game would be just 5-points. Denver shot just 44% from the field, 33% from beyond the arc and 78% from the free throw line; despite that they managed to win Game 1.

The Clippers shot 50% from the field, 35% from 3 but turned the ball over 20 times. The Nuggets turned those 20 turnovers into 29 points the other way and it’s the biggest reason the Nuggets snuck away with a 2-point win.

Leonard finished the game with 7 turnovers of his own, playing 41 minutes and scoring just 22 points; despite the 60% shooting night. Zubac was utilized perfectly, scoring 21 points, grabbing 10 rebounds and shooting 66% from the field.

Ivica Zubac o32.5 PRA (-120 via BetOnline)

Ivica Zubac celebrates a made basket.

Playing with James Harden will forever make you look good on a basketball court. Zubac looks like an All-NBA Center this year and it’s just another testament to how much fun playing with James Harden can be. Zubac is averaging 19.7 PPG in his L20 games, in addition to 13.0 RPG and 3.2 APG.

Zubz played 39 minutes in Game 1, scored 21 points, grabbed 13 rebounds and 6 offensive rebounds. With Nikola Jokic on the court, the Clippers best matchup is Zubac and they’ll need him out there for as long as he can go. He was able to put preassure on the Nuggets by making Jokic defend and my crashing the offensive glass for 2nd chance scoring opportunities.

Zubz cleared this line in 13 of his L20 games, averaging 21.4 rebounding chances per game and even adding 4 offensive rebounds per contest. He’s having his best season of his career and now in the postseason, the Clippers will need him to maintain that same level of play.
